Why is Venezuelan oil so attractive to US refiners?

Venezuelan oil is especially attractive to U.S. refiners because it is heavier than what is available domestically. And it takes relatively little time to ship the oil to the Gulf Coast, where facilities are configured to process a mixture of cheaper, heavier oil and more expensive light oil.

Why is Venezuela struggling to extract tar-like oil?

Venezuela pumped almost 5 percent of the world's oil in 1997, but years of mismanagement, underinvestment and U.S. sanctions have squeezed output. The difficulty of extracting the country's tar-like oil has also complicated matters. Source: U.S. Energy Information Administration.

Will Venezuela hit a coal production target?

It is not clear if the government hit that target. In 2019, the U.S. Geological Survey estimated that Venezuela produced 100,000 metric tons of coal from 731 million metric tons of reserves. Much of the country's production of minerals, including nickel, bauxite, iron ore, and gold, has fallen alongside oil in the past decade.
